本文将介绍如何掌握软件制作技巧,从而打造属于自己的高级APK软件。通过学习本文的内容,你将能够轻松掌握软件开发的技巧,为银州的APP市场贡献一份力量。
1. 确定你的软件开发目标
在开始软件开发之前,你需要确立自己的开发目标。你的目标可能是开发一款游戏,一款工具软件,或者是一款社交媒体应用。无论你的目标是什么,你都需要明确你的软件的功能和目标用户,并根据这些要求对开发流程做出相应规划。
2. 学习软件开发技术
软件开发需要特定的技术知识,在软件开发前,你需要学习掌握这些技术。你需要了解编程语言、开发工具、代码管理技术等等。以Java为例,你需要了解Java语言基础、Android应用架构、XML布局文件等等。
3. 搭建开发环境
在学习并掌握开发技术后,下一步就是搭建开发环境。你需要在电脑上安装相应的软件,例如Android Studio开发工具。同时,你需要安装相应的SDK和插件,这些都是进行软件开发必不可少的。
4. 开始软件开发
在学习必要的技术和搭建相应的开发环境后,你可以开始进行软件开发了。你要设计软件的基本框架、编写代码、进行调试。建议你先开发一版简易版的软件,然后再逐步完善和优化。
5. 测试和上线发布
在软件开发完成之后,你需要对软件进行测试和优化。你可以请朋友做测试,或者提交到测试平台进行测试。最后,当你的软件被用户广泛认可后,你可以将其上线发布。
软件开发是一个长期的过程,需要耐心和毅力。但只要你掌握了相应的技术和能力,你就可以打造出属于自己的高级APK软件。祝愿各位开发者们能够早日实现自己的开发梦想,让更多人受益。
随着移动设备不断普及,apk软件成为了移动应用的重要组成部分。如果您想要打造一个属于自己的高级apk软件,本篇教程将为您介绍制作apk软件的技巧和步骤。本教程主要包括以下五个部分:1、了解apk软件的定义和组成部分;2、掌握android系统的基本知识;3、设计apk软件的界面和功能;4、编码和发布apk软件;5、优化apk软件的性能和使用体验。通过本篇教程,您将学会如何制作一个高质量的apk软件并在市场上获得成功。
1. 了解apk软件的定义和组成部分
apk软件即安卓应用软件,是一种基于android系统开发并使用.apk为文件扩展名的应用程序。一个apk软件一般由多个组件组成,包括:java代码、资源文件、xml文件、manifest文件和.dex文件等等。其中xml文件用于描述界面布局和数据结构,manifest文件则用于描述apk软件的基本信息和权限等等。了解apk软件的组成部分对于后续的制作和调试工作非常有帮助。
2. 掌握android系统的基本知识
制作apk软件需要熟悉android系统的基本架构和API接口。android系统是一种基于Linux内核的开源操作系统,具有Java语言和Dalvik虚拟机等特点。开发者需要利用android SDK工具集和Eclipse集成开发环境等工具进行apk软件的开发和调试。掌握android系统的基本知识是制作高级apk软件的必备条件。
3. 设计apk软件的界面和功能
设计apk软件的界面和功能是打造一款成功应用的重要环节。设计良好的用户界面可以提高用户的使用体验和产品的市场竞争力。在设计apk软件时,需要考虑用户的需求、产品的特点和市场的情况等因素。开发者需要掌握相关的设计工具和技巧,如Photoshop和Illustrator等软件,同时需注意产品的易用性和美观性。
4. 编码和发布apk软件
在完成apk软件的设计和功能模块后,开发者需要进行编码和测试。编码过程中需要注意代码的规范性和可读性,避免出现漏洞和安全问题。测试过程也需要对apk软件的各项功能进行检验,保证软件的质量和稳定性。最后,开发者需要将apk软件发布到应用市场和网站等平台上,吸引更多用户的关注和下载。
5. 优化apk软件的性能和使用体验
优化apk软件的性能和使用体验可以提高软件的品质和用户满意度。优化的方面主要包括应用程序的响应速度、运行效率、内存占用和电量消耗等。开发者可以通过对代码和软件架构等方面进行优化来提高软件的性能和体验。同时,注意用户的反馈和建议也是优化软件的重要环节。
本篇教程介绍了如何打造一个属于自己的高级apk软件。从了解apk软件的组成部分开始,到掌握android系统的基本知识、设计apk软件的界面和功能、编码和发布apk软件,最后优化apk软件的性能和使用体验。通过本篇教程,相信大家已经对apk软件的制作流程有了初步了解,同时也增强了掌握相关技能的信心。希望本篇教程对大家的apk软件制作之路有所帮助。